If you are a music producer, you’ve likely encountered the term FLRegKey. It is the registry file used by Image-Line to unlock FL Studio from its trial mode into a full, functional version. However, searching for terms like "flregkey reg download better" often leads to a rabbit hole of third-party sites and potential security threats. What is an FLRegKey?

An FLRegKey.reg file is a small piece of data that adds your license information to your computer's Windows Registry. When FL Studio opens, it checks this registry entry to see if the user has a valid license. If it finds a match, the "Trial" watermark disappears, and features like project saving and reloading are enabled. The Risks of Downloading FLRegKey Files from Third Parties flregkey reg download better

Many users search for "better" or "working" registry keys on forums or file-sharing sites to avoid paying for the software. Here is why that is usually a bad idea:

Malware and Trojans: Registry files can be scripted to execute commands. Malicious actors often bundle "cracked" keys with spyware that can steal your passwords or encrypt your files.

Stability Issues: Unofficial keys often use outdated license formats. This can cause FL Studio to crash, behave unpredictably, or fail to recognize your VST plugins.

No "Lifetime Free Updates": One of FL Studio's best features is the "Lifetime Free Updates" policy. If you use a pirated key, you cannot update to the latest version without risking a "License Blocked" error. The "Better" Way: Official Registration

Rather than searching for a "better" download link on shady websites, the most stable and secure method is to use the official Image-Line registration system. 1. The Modern Method (No File Needed)

In recent versions of FL Studio (20 and 21), you no longer need to manually download an .reg file. Open FL Studio. Go to Help > About. Enter your Image-Line account email and password. Restart the software.

This automatically creates the "better" registry entry for you, ensuring it is perfectly synced with your specific hardware and software version. 2. The Manual FLRegKey Download Follow this protocol to ensure success and safety

If you are working on a computer without an internet connection, you can still download your unique key officially: Log into your account on the Image-Line website. Navigate to your Unlock Products section.

Click the "Unlock Products" icon (the orange keyboard) to download your personal FLRegKey.Reg. Why Buying is Better than Downloading
